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a printer for a paper sheet roll capable of executing safely work by a worker, without bringing a finger into contact with a blade tip when replacing the paper sheet roll or the like, even when a lid is opened. <P>SOLUTION: This printer for the paper sheet roll is constituted of a printer body 12 provided with a printing head 16, and a paper piece cutting means 23 installed in a front position of the printing head 16 to cut a supplied paper piece part after printed, and a paper sheet roll cover 32 provided with a platen roller 39 and of communicating freely printing onto the paper sheet roll with a printer body 12 side, the paper piece cutting means 23 is provided with a support body 24 arranged along a longitudinal direction of the printing head 16, and a cutting edge 28 projected with the blade tip 29 from an front end 24a side of the support body 24, and the support body 24 is arranged allowing freely forcible motion of energizing the blade tip 29 all the time to be brought into a substantially parallel direction, when the paper sheet roll cover 32 is completely lid-opened, and of directing downwards the blade tip 29 by abutting, when completely lid-closed.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2010,JPO&amp;INPIT

Description

本発明は、装填されているロール紙から引き出された印字後の供給紙片部を切断する紙片切断手段を備えて縦置きされるロール紙用プリンタに関する技術である。 The present invention is a technique relating to vertical is rolled printer paper Ru comprise paper cutting means for cutting the supply paper portions after printing drawn from roll paper is loaded.

波形記録計などの計測機器には、記録紙に波形などの必要情報を印字するプリンタを備えているものもあり、この場合に用いられる記録紙としては、感熱紙からなるロール紙が用いられ、プリンタとしては、サーマルプリンタが用いられる例が多い。   Some measuring devices such as waveform recorders are equipped with a printer that prints necessary information such as waveforms on recording paper. As recording paper used in this case, roll paper made of thermal paper is used, As a printer, a thermal printer is often used.

そして、ロール紙から引き出された印字後の供給紙片部は、プリンタ本体が備える排出口から排出され、該排出口側に付設されているカッターを用いて切断できようになっている。   Then, the printed paper piece drawn from the roll paper is discharged from a discharge port provided in the printer body and can be cut using a cutter attached to the discharge port side.

しかし、排出口側にカッターを付設する場合には、予めロール紙から供給紙片部を引き出して排出口内を通過させた上で、印字作業を行う必要がある。   However, when a cutter is attached to the discharge port side, it is necessary to perform a printing operation after previously pulling out the supply paper piece from the roll paper and passing it through the discharge port.

この場合、周辺湿度が低い場合には、排出口から印字後の供給紙片部を円滑に送り出すことができるものの、湿度が高い場合には、供給紙片部側も湿気を吸ってその横幅が広がって引っかかりやすくなり、排出口から円滑に送り出せなくなる問題があった。   In this case, when the peripheral humidity is low, the supplied paper piece portion after printing can be smoothly fed out from the discharge port. However, when the humidity is high, the supply paper piece side also absorbs moisture and its width is widened. There was a problem that it was easily caught and could not be smoothly fed out from the outlet.

このため、プリンタのなかには、下記特許文献1にも示されているように、プリンタ本体に対しロール紙カバーを引き開き自在に取り付け、排出口を特に設けることなく閉蓋時のロール紙カバーとプリンタ本体側との間に隙間を確保し、該隙間を利用して印字後の供給紙片部を円滑に送り出し、かつ、プリンタ本体側に固定配置されているカッターで切断することができるようにしたプリンタも既に提案されている。
特開2007−45557号公報
For this reason, as shown in the following Patent Document 1, some printers have a roll paper cover attached to the printer body so that the roll paper cover can be opened and opened, and a roll paper cover and printer at the time of closing without specially providing a discharge port. A printer that secures a gap with the main body side, smoothly feeds out the supplied paper piece after printing, and can be cut with a cutter fixedly arranged on the printer main body side. Has already been proposed.
JP 2007-45557 A

しかし、上記特許文献1に示されているようにプリンタ本体にロール紙カバーを引き開き自在に取り付けるタイプのものは、ロール紙交換などの開蓋時にあっても固定配置されているカッターの刃先が常に下向きとなって露出しているため、これに作業者が誤って手指を接触させてしまうおそれがあるという不都合があった。   However, as shown in the above-mentioned Patent Document 1, the type in which the roll paper cover is attached to the printer main body so that the roll paper can be freely opened has a blade edge of the cutter that is fixedly disposed even when the roll paper is opened such as when the roll paper is replaced. Since the exposure is always downward, there is a problem that the operator may accidentally touch the finger.

本発明は、従来技術にみられた上記課題に鑑み、ロール紙交換時などの開蓋時であっても手指を刃先に触れずらくすることで、作業者が安全裡に作業を遂行できるようにした縦置きタイプのロール紙用プリンタを提供することを目的とする。 In view of the above-mentioned problems found in the prior art, the present invention makes it possible for an operator to safely perform a work by making it difficult to touch a fingertip with a finger even when the roll paper is opened, such as when replacing roll paper. An object of the present invention is to provide a vertical type roll paper printer.

本発明によれば、印字時に下向きに位置していた切断刃の刃先は、ロール紙交換時などのようにロール紙カバーを引き開いた際に、簡単な構成のもとで自動的に略水平方向に位置移動させることができるので、開蓋作業時に作業者が手指を刃先に触れるおそれをそれだけ少なくして、安全裡に作業を遂行することができる。 According to the present invention, the cutting edge of the cutting blade which is located downwardly during printing, when opening pull the roll paper cover, such as during roll paper replacement, automatically substantially horizontal under simple structure Since the position can be moved in the direction, the risk of the operator touching the blade edge during the opening operation is reduced, and the operation can be performed safely.

図1は、本発明の一例につき、ロール紙カバーをプリンタ本体側から引き開いた開蓋状態のもとでロール紙とともに示す全体斜視図である。また、図2は、図1に示す例を示す側面図であり、そのうちの(a)はロール紙カバーでプリンタ本体側を完全閉蓋した際の状態を、(b)はロール紙カバーを完全開蓋させた状態をそれぞれ示す。   FIG. 1 is an overall perspective view showing a roll paper cover together with the roll paper in an open state in which the roll paper cover is opened from the printer main body side according to an example of the present invention. 2 is a side view showing the example shown in FIG. 1, in which (a) shows the state when the printer main body side is completely closed with a roll paper cover, and (b) shows the roll paper cover completely. Each of the opened states is shown.

これらの図によれば、縦置きタイプのロール紙用プリンタ11の全体は、印字ヘッド16と、該印字ヘッド16の前方位置に設置されてロール紙42から引き出された印字後の供給紙片部を切断する紙片切断手段23などを備えるプリンタ本体12と、ール紙42を交換する交換する際などのプリンタ本体12側からの引き開きと装填されるロール紙42への印字ヘッド16による印字を行う際の押し閉じとを可能とすべく、一対の支腕部34,35を介してプリンタ本体側に揺動自在に取り付けられるプラテンローラ付きのロール紙カバーとで構成されている。 According to these drawings, the entire vertically placed roll paper printer 11 includes a print head 16 and a supply paper piece portion after printing that is installed at a position in front of the print head 16 and pulled out from the roll paper 42. a printer body 12 with a like paper cutting means 23 for cutting, and pulling opening from the printer body 12 side, such as when replacing exchanging b Lumpur paper 42, printing by the print head 16 to the roll paper 42 to be loaded In order to be able to be pushed and closed when performing the operation, it is constituted by a roll paper cover with a platen roller that is swingably attached to the printer main body side via a pair of support arm portions 34 and 35 .

このうち、プリンタ本体12は、図示しない波形記録計などの計測機器側に縦置きして組み込むことができる左右一対の側板部13,14と、これら側板部13,14相互間に架け渡された天板部15とを備えた略門型形状が付与されて形成されている。 Among these, the printer main body 12 is spanned between a pair of left and right side plate portions 13 and 14 that can be vertically installed on a measuring instrument such as a waveform recorder (not shown), and the side plate portions 13 and 14. A substantially gate-like shape including the top plate portion 15 is provided and formed.

そして、サーマルヘッドからなる印字ヘッド16は、天板部15の下面側にその長さ方向(左右方向)に沿わせて配設されている。   The print head 16 composed of a thermal head is arranged along the length direction (left-right direction) on the lower surface side of the top plate portion 15.

ロール紙カバー32は、ホルダ43付きのロール紙42を収容する凹曲カバー本体部33と、該凹曲カバー本体部33の左右に配置されてプリンタ本体12の側板部13,14側に揺動自在に連結される一対の支腕部34,35とを備えて形成されている。   The roll paper cover 32 is disposed on the left and right sides of the concave cover main body portion 33 for accommodating the roll paper 42 with the holder 43 and swings toward the side plate portions 13 and 14 of the printer main body 12. A pair of support arms 34 and 35 that are freely connected are formed.

そして、プラテンローラ39は、ロール紙カバー32をプリンタ本体12側に完全閉蓋して印字できるようにセットした際に、印字ヘッド16の発熱面側に位置するようにして配設されている。   The platen roller 39 is disposed so as to be positioned on the heat generating surface side of the print head 16 when the roll paper cover 32 is set to be completely closed on the printer main body 12 side so that printing can be performed.

一方、紙片切断手段23は、印字ヘッド16の長さ方向に沿わせて配設される支持本体部24と、該支持本体部24の前端24a側から刃先29を印字ヘッド16の発熱面方向と交差する下向きに突出させてその長さ方向に配置される切断刃28とを備えて形成されている。 On the other hand, the paper piece cutting means 23 includes a support main body 24 arranged along the length direction of the print head 16, and the cutting edge 29 from the front end 24 a side of the support main body 24 to the heat generation surface direction of the print head 16. It is formed with a cutting blade 28 that protrudes downward in an intersecting manner and is disposed in the length direction thereof.

この場合、支持本体部24は、ロール紙カバー32が開かれた開蓋時に刃先29がロール紙42の出入方向である略水平向きとなるように常に付勢され、ロール紙カバー32が閉じられた閉蓋時に先29が下向きとなるように強制的な移動を可能にして配設されている。 In this case, the support main body 24 is always urged so that the blade edge 29 is in a substantially horizontal direction that is the direction in which the roll paper 42 is put in and out when the roll paper cover 32 is opened, and the roll paper cover 32 is closed. blade destination 29 when closed is arranged to allow the forced movement such that downward.

すなわち、支持本体部24は、プリンタ本体12の両側板部13,14に支軸17を介して回動自在に配設されている。また、支軸17には、図3に示すように捩りばね18が介装配置されており、ロール紙カバー32が完全開蓋状態となった際に、捩りばね18により刃先29が常に略水平向きとなる姿勢をとるように付勢した状態で支持本体部24を軸支している。   That is, the support main body 24 is rotatably disposed on both side plate portions 13 and 14 of the printer main body 12 via the support shaft 17. Further, as shown in FIG. 3, a torsion spring 18 is disposed on the support shaft 17, and when the roll paper cover 32 is fully opened, the cutting edge 29 is always substantially horizontal by the torsion spring 18. The support main body 24 is pivotally supported in a state of being biased so as to take a posture to be oriented.

しかも、支持本体部24は、長さ方向(図1では左右方向)での両側面25,26に当接ガイド片27が各別に設けられており、ロール紙カバー32が両支腕部34,35に備える当接部36がその施蓋時に当接ガイド片2と当接することで強制的に回転させられ、刃先29を下向きに配置することができるようになっている。 In addition, the support main body 24 is provided with contact guide pieces 27 on both side surfaces 25 and 26 in the length direction (left and right direction in FIG. 1), and the roll paper cover 32 includes both support arm portions 34 and abutment 36 provided in 35 is forced to rotate by contact with the contact guide piece 2 7 at the time of applying a cover, so that it is possible to place the cutting edge 29 downward.

これを図4に基づいて左側に位置する支腕部34との関係で具体的に説明する。図4は、紙片切断手段とロール紙カバーとの配置関係を示す説明図であり、そのうちの(a)はロール紙カバー32が完全閉蓋された際の状態を、(b)はロール紙カバー32の支腕部34側と支持本体部24側とが未だ接触状態を保ちつつ開蓋途上にある状態を、(c)は支腕部34側が支持本体部24側との接触状態を完全に脱した際の開蓋途上の状態をそれぞれ示す。   This will be specifically described with reference to FIG. 4 in relation to the support arm 34 located on the left side. 4A and 4B are explanatory views showing the positional relationship between the paper piece cutting means and the roll paper cover, in which (a) shows the state when the roll paper cover 32 is completely closed, and (b) shows the roll paper cover. 32 shows a state in which the support arm portion 34 side and the support main body portion 24 side are still in contact with each other, and FIG. The state in the middle of opening the lid when removed is shown.

図2(a)および図4(a)に示されているようにロール紙カバー32が完全施蓋状態にあるときは、支腕部34が備える当接部36が捩りばね18の付勢力に抗して支持本体部24が側面25に備える当接ガイド片27の基端部27aを強制的に押し上げる結果、その反対側である前端24a側に位置する切断刃28もその刃先29が下方を向いた状態となる。したがって、ロール紙42から引き出されて印字を終えた供給紙片部は、直上位置にある刃先29を介していつでも切断できる状態におくことができる。なお、図4(a)に示す完全閉蓋時には、プラテンローラを切断刃28よりも内奥に位置させた状態のもとで、刃先29の下方に供給紙片部を送り出すための隙間sを確保することができるようになっている。 As shown in FIGS. 2A and 4A, when the roll paper cover 32 is in a completely covered state, the abutting portion 36 included in the support arm portion 34 acts on the biasing force of the torsion spring 18. As a result, the support main body 24 forcibly pushes up the base end portion 27a of the abutting guide piece 27 provided on the side surface 25. As a result, the cutting edge 28 of the cutting blade 28 positioned on the front end 24a side, which is the opposite side, also has a lower cutting edge 29. It will be in the state of facing. Therefore, the supply paper piece portion that has been drawn out of the roll paper 42 and finished printing can be kept in a state where it can be cut at any time via the blade edge 29 located immediately above. When the cover is completely closed as shown in FIG. 4A, a gap s for feeding the supply paper piece portion below the blade edge 29 is secured under the state where the platen roller is located inward of the cutting blade 28. Can be done.

一方、ロール紙42の交換などのようにロール紙カバー32を開く必要がある場合には、ロール紙カバー32側を前方向へと引き開くことにより、図4(b)に示すように支腕部34,35が備える当接部36側と当接ガイド片27との当接状態は解消されるものの、支腕部34の先端部34aが当接ガイド片27の基端部27aとの当接を維持しているので、刃先29は依然として下方を向いている。   On the other hand, when it is necessary to open the roll paper cover 32, for example, when the roll paper 42 is replaced, the support arm as shown in FIG. 4B is opened by pulling the roll paper cover 32 side forward. Although the contact state between the contact portion 36 side of the portions 34 and 35 and the contact guide piece 27 is eliminated, the distal end portion 34a of the support arm portion 34 is in contact with the proximal end portion 27a of the contact guide piece 27. Since the contact is maintained, the cutting edge 29 still faces downward.

しかし、支腕部34の先端部34aは、図4(c)に示すようにロール紙カバー32の開度がより大きくなると、当接ガイド片27の基端部27aとの当接状態が解消され、捩りばね18の付勢力により支持本体部24が回転して前端24aが持ち上がり、刃先も29も略水平方向を向くように移動する。   However, when the opening degree of the roll paper cover 32 becomes larger as shown in FIG. 4C, the contact state between the distal end portion 34 a of the support arm portion 34 and the proximal end portion 27 a of the contact guide piece 27 is eliminated. Then, the support main body 24 is rotated by the urging force of the torsion spring 18 so that the front end 24a is lifted, and both the blade edge 29 and the blade 29 are moved in the substantially horizontal direction.

そして、図4(c)に示す状態をさらに進めて図2(b)に示すようにロール紙カバー32を完全開蓋させ、かつ、プリンタ本体12側の紙片切断手段23を刃先29が略水平方向を向く状態におくことで、手指が刃先29に触れるおそれをなくして図1に示すように安全裡にロール紙32を交換することができる。   Then, the state shown in FIG. 4C is further advanced to completely open the roll paper cover 32 as shown in FIG. 2B, and the cutting edge 23 of the paper piece cutting means 23 on the printer main body 12 side is substantially horizontal. By setting it in a state of facing the direction, the roll paper 32 can be safely replaced as shown in FIG.
